Former President Donald Trump has issued new tariff rates, extending the deadline for their implementation while signaling openness to negotiations. This development has created uncertainty in the global economy, with experts analyzing the potential impacts on the U.S. economy, various sectors, and the bond market. Trump's announcement, described as a 'tariff letter bomb,' includes warnings to revise existing policies. The situation remains dynamic as stakeholders assess who will be most affected by these tariff adjustments. Additionally, geopolitical tensions involving Ukraine and Russia continue to be part of the broader discussion surrounding Trump's policy decisions.
